Forest Hunter is thrilled to announce the addition of Seattle's Best Sierra to our
line up of leading ladies. Sierra is a Nahaeta grand daughter. She is out of
Mojoscathouse Descartes and Seattle's Best Calex.

She is a poly shorthair girl with more spots than I have ever seen on a cat - there
are simply no bars on her. She has spots even on her feet and her shoulders. It
doesn't hurt that she's got a nice face on top of all her other traits.

Although her tail will keep her from the show ring, expect to see one of her
daughters or sons represent her one of these days.

Big Bad Boy
By Brenda Miller
at
AlpineLegends Pixie Bobs
Big Bad Boy made his trip from France to America with the courage of an adult cat. He was definitely a favorite at the
cargo holding area. After being in the air for a day and a half, he was still chipper and ready for attention. I was so
excited to meet this beautiful boy. The first thing I did when I got him to the car was open the cage. My heart about
burst, he was everything that Nathalie Bent had said he was and more. I just want to take this opportunity to thank
Nathalie for trusting me with this very prized and beautiful boy.

I look at Big Bad Boys face and I can see his famous father Meow Gibson so clearly. Big Bad Boy loves to watch the deer
out of my big double glass doors. He, at times, has races with the squirrels and chipmunks on the deck, except he is in
the house and they are outside. He is quite the character.

It will not be long before Big Bad Boy becomes a father just like his brother Big Wild Boy. I cannot wait until the time
comes for him to sire his own beautiful kittens. I have no doubt that they will be just like him, a great looking example
of a Pixie Bob and full of fun and excitement. He has definitely found a forever home with AlpineLegends.
